About Berkshire Hathaway (BRK-B)
Berkshire Hathaway is a multinational conglomerate holding company led by renowned investor Warren Buffett. The company primarily engages in the acquisition and management of a diverse range of businesses across various industries, including insurance, utility, energy, rail transportation, manufacturing, and retail. By employing a value investing approach, Berkshire Hathaway seeks to identify and invest in companies with strong growth potential and effective management. In addition to its numerous wholly-owned subsidiaries, the firm also holds significant stakes in several publicly traded companies, reinforcing its position as a prominent player in the global investment landscape. Constellation Brands (NYSE: STZ), one of the just 42 stocks in Berkshire Hathaway's (NYSE: BRK.B) portfolio, has experienced a strong recovery from its recent lows. Shares dropped as low as $127 in November 2025, a level that seemed overly pessimistic despite headwinds in the alcohol industry. The consumer staples stock has now rebounded above $160, constituting more than a 25% move to the upside.
